Most popular baby girl names in Montana in 1931

Based on the data from Montana in 1931, Mary was the most popular name for baby girls with 184 occurrences, followed closely by Betty with 166 occurrences. Dorothy was the third most popular name with 103 occurrences, followed by Patricia with 100 occurrences, and Donna with 98 occurrences. These were the top five baby girl names in Montana in 1931.

Most popular baby boy names in Montana in 1931

In Montana, 1931, the most popular baby boy names were Robert with 251 occurrences, followed by John with 220 occurrences, Donald with 180 occurrences, William with 168 occurrences, and James with 167 occurrences.
